C# と VB.NET の質問掲示板
ASP.NET、C++/CLI、Java 何でもどうぞ
C# と VB.NET の入門サイト
Re[2]: yyyyMMddHHmmssを、Date型に変換する方法
(過去ログ 66 を表示中)
掲示板トップ
C# と VB.NET 入門
新規作成
利用方法/規約
トピック表示
ランキング
記事検索
過去ログ
[トピック内 3 記事 (1 - 3 表示)] <<
0
>>
■38680
/ inTopicNo.1)
yyyyMMddHHmmssを、Date型に変換する方法
▼
■
□投稿者/ Yoco
(1回)-(2009/07/23(Thu) 13:03:17)
分類:[VB.NET/VB2005 以降]
はじめまして。
VB、超初心者です。。。
yyyyMMddHHmmssの文字列を、Date型に変換したいのですが
エラーになってしまいます。
Dim dtYmd As Date = Date.ParseExact("20090608200847", "yyyyMMddHHmmss", CultureInfo.InvariantCulture)
エラー:文字列は有効な DateTime ではありませんでした。
ヘルプを見たり色々調べてみましたが、難しくて理解できませんでした。(泣)
すみませんが、ご教授お願いします☆
【環境】
WindowsXP SP2、VB2005
足りない情報があるかと思います…。ご面倒ですがご指摘ください。
引用返信
編集キー/
編集
■38683
/ inTopicNo.2)
Re[1]: yyyyMMddHHmmssを、Date型に変換する方法
▲
▼
■
□投稿者/ Hongliang
(434回)-(2009/07/23(Thu) 13:12:00)
そのコードのままなら、なんら問題なく実行して結果を取得できます。
おそらく、実際に渡されている日付文字列(このコードで言うところの "20090608200847")に余計な文字が入っているとか逆に字数が足りていないとか、そういうことでしょう。
引用返信
編集キー/
編集
■38684
/ inTopicNo.3)
Re[2]: yyyyMMddHHmmssを、Date型に変換する方法
▲
▼
■
□投稿者/ Yoco
(3回)-(2009/07/23(Thu) 13:28:35)
Hongliang さん。
早速のご回答、ありがとうございます。
確かに余分な空白が入っていました。。。
もう少し自力で確認してから質問するべきだった…と反省です。(>_<)
助かりました☆
ありがとうございました!!
解決済み
引用返信
編集キー/
編集
トピック内ページ移動 / <<
0
>>
このトピックに書きこむ
過去ログには書き込み不可
管理者用
-
Child Tree
-